I also block many of the fuskers by using image filenames based off of a random SHA-1. The benefit of doing this is that images share no consecutive naming elements, which prevents many of the fusker scripts from leeching them automatically.

Fuskers are run by people too lazy to re-host the images on a free host, thus forcing them to load each filename by hand (or an advanced image extractor) requires a lot more work on their end than simply specifying "sampleimage[1-16].jpg".
